### MTX Acquires Stralto: A Strategic Move to Enhance Cloud-Based Solutions
In a significant development in the tech industry, MTX has announced its acquisition of Stralto, a technology service and solutions company specializing in cloud-based enterprise solutions. The financial details of the transaction remain undisclosed, but the merger is expected to bolster MTX's capabilities in providing innovative solutions across various sectors.
Founded in 2018, Stralto has quickly positioned itself as a leader in AI-driven solutions that simplify and enhance local and state government operations. With a team comprised of former public servants and technology veterans, Stralto has developed a suite of tools designed to improve citizen engagement and streamline complex processes. This includes their flagship offerings such as Civicare for citizen assistance programs and DMx for document management.
MTX, known for its deep expertise in cloud technology and a commitment to driving digital transformation, sees this acquisition as a pivotal step in expanding its service portfolio. With a decade of experience in implementing enterprise solutions in the cloud, Stralto's innovative approach aligns seamlessly with MTX's vision of delivering next-gen solutions powered by the Microsoft Cloud.
